I just finished bingeing the entire seven seasons. I'd seen it before. At one point in the story, maybe season five or so, the series's chief figure of ridicule, Jonah Ryan, manages to run for president and actually does well. As a Member of Congress, he managed to form his own caucus in the House. The basis for his appeal is his adoption of MAGA talking points, well before the ascent of Trump. The overlap between his absurdities and actual popular sentiment is striking. One of his hobby horses is to abolish Daylight Saving Time. Another is to denounce "Muslim math." Of course he plots with his gang to blow up debt ceiling negotiations. The least realistic points are when the character goes into extreme acts of self-sabotage and unaccountably survives politically, but of course Trump has done that too.
